Energy should be used more effective and sufficient to gear to nation's lasting developing strategy. VAR and harmonic has became serious pollution in circuit, it results in abnormal working of various equipments in electric system, bringing Energy Waste , simultaneity, threatening to circuit safety.VAR compensation has been proved an effective measure to reduce electric circuit loss and to increase working-system stable level. Based on DSP this paper design and implement a kind of SVC controller . First of all, we introduce the relevant technology of DSP and multi-DSP parallel processing. More, some scheme was analyzed and compared in the paper and the scheme that based on double DSP and exterior Analog-Digital module is selected. In the scheme, the controller's CPU is TMS320F2812. And its peripherals include signal processing, pluses magnifying, LCD, key processing etc. The C language and assembly language are both used to implement the controller main program and each module program. The modules are data collection module and computing module and LCD module and man-machine conversation module. Moreover, the communication protocol between two controllers was seted up and implemented.The communication protocol between controller and monitor also was seted up and implemented. The results show that the control strategy is valid and creditable, more, its respond speed is high and satisfy the design demand.
